No.74 Fighter Squadron - Sweat Shirt B-25 Mitchell The earliest combat action wasNo. 74 Fighter Squadron No. 74 Training Squadron started operational life in 1917, but was reformed as a Royal Flying Corps Fighter Squadron in 1918 and moved onto the Western Front. In combat, the Squadron developed a fierce reputation with a tiger like aggression. A spirit that has stayed with this Squadron until it was disbanded in 2000.
